Designed for the needs of Internet-savvy consumers, the Nokia N97 combines a large 3.5" touch display with a full QWERTY keyboard, providing an ‘always open’ window to favorite social networking sites and Internet destinations. Nokia’s flagship Nseries device introduces leading technology - including multiple sensors, memory, processing power and connection speeds - for people to create a personal Internet and share their ‘social location.’

Nokia N97

The Nokia N97 is a GSM 850/900/1800/1900 phone utilising the GPRS/EDGE/UMTS/HSDPA 1.8 Mbits/HSDPA 3.6Mbit/s network. It is a 3G and Smartphone that operates on the Symbian 9.4 S60 5th Edition OS. It has an internal memory of 32 GB, with expandable memory slot up to 16 GB through microSD. The handset measures 4.6 x 2.2 x 0.6 inch, weighing 5.3 oz. Its internal display screen is 3.5 inch at 16 million coloue TFT multi-touch LCD 16 : 9 widescreen with a resolution of 640 x 360 pixels. The N97 battery provides a talktime of up to 6.66 hours and standby time of 430 hours. It utilises a full QWERTY keyboard.

Features

The Nokia N97 supports POP3/IMAP4/SMTP/Microsoft Exchange and has SMS, MMS, EMS and internet browsing capabilities via its S60 OS browser. It also features RSS news feed and Instant Messenging. The Nokia N97 has a 5 megapixel camera with carl Zeiss Tessar lens with an aperture value of f/2.8 and focal length of 5.4mm. Its maximum resolution of 2584 x 1938 pixel. On video mode the camera records at VGA 640x 480 resolutions at 30 frames per second, DVD quality video capture, and support for services like Share on Ovi for sharing over HSDPA and WLAN. Other features on the N97 are an MP3 music player. Connectivity is via Bluetooth 2.0 with A2DP, Wi-fi (WLAN) and USB (microUSB 2.0). The Nokia N97 has a built-in Assisted-GPS, touch enabled Nokia Maps and a Digital Compass, and also has a TV output for PAL/NTSC output, a 3.5 mm headset and computer synchronisation with PC.
